Greg Stark <gsstark@mit.edu> writes:
> My understanding is that the entire set of localization parameters needs to be
> decided upon when the initdb is done and can never be changed later. Is that
> right?

No, not all of them are frozen.  Unfortunately, the one you care about
(LC_COLLATE) is.  The reason for this is that it determines index
ordering for textual columns, and so changing LC_COLLATE on the fly
produces instant corrupt indexes :-(

A solution for this is on the TODO list, but don't hold your breath ...
